Overview
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th confirmed the Pentagon has contingency plans for potential invasions of Greenland and Panama if necessary.
Democratic members of the House Armed Services Committee challenged Hegseth during discussions about these contingency plans.
A watchdog report regarding Hegseth's communication practices is anticipated, following his statements on military plans.
Hegseth emphasized that while plans exist, sharing classified military information with lawmakers is not feasible.
The Pentagon maintains that it prepares for various scenarios, including the possibility of military action in Greenland and Panama.
